Course Aims
- Describe the scope of carpentry; differentiate between various timber products, and discuss the correct use of each
- Describe all major carpentry tools and pinpoint appropriate uses for each. Identify and manage risk in a carpentry work environment.
- Describe different techniques for cutting wood in a variety of different circumstances
- Describe and compare different techniques for wood joining
- Undertake a small carpentry project of your own
- Explain a range of common carpentry tasks that a handyman may need to undertake in routine maintenance and repair work.
- Explain the different techniques for finishing wood
- Determine an appropriate approach for planning a timber project
- Explain how a site should be set out in preparation for a project
Programme Structure
Courses Include:- Scope and Nature of Carpentry
- Carpentry Tools, Equipment, Materials and Safety
- Cutting and Joining Timber
- Small Carpentry Projects
- Outside Construction
- Constructing Small Buildings
- House Construction
- Handyman Repair Work
- Finishing Wood
- Planning and Setting Out a Project
